Based on my understandings from today’s homily, we should always be ready to accept the
consequences of our actions as our own and not blame God. When we commit mistakes, we should
always remember that God wants the best for us and the challenges that we face in our time here on
earth will help mold us to become better persons in the future. God is our source of strength, when
facing these tough times, we should remember that no matter how rough the waves are, He is still there
guiding us in ways that are both imaginable and unimaginable. Instead of blaming God that we are going
through a rough patch, we should use our faith in God to become better people and overcome these
obstacles. Let us be good Christians and honest citizens and always do well so that we can be like Jesus.
